#51148a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51148a is composed of 31.8% red, 7.8%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 85.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 271 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 31%. #51148a color hex could be obtained by blending #a228ff with #000015.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#51148a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51148a has RGB values of R:81, G:20,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 5313674.

Shades and Tints of #51148a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f6effd is the lightest one.

Tones of #51148a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4b53 is the less saturated color, while #52029c is the most saturated one.
